Foods to avoid for breakfast when reducing belly fat
1. Processed foods, fried foods high in oil
Many people, because they are busy, choose breakfast with processed foods or fast food.
These foods are not good for health, often containing a lot of bad fats, carbohydrates, spices, etc., not only cause a quick hunger, making you crave snacks but also promote belly fat storage.
2. Foods that are too salty or too sweet
sweets and sugary drinks are top foods that cause weight gain and increase the risk of diabetes. More dangerously, sugar can be addictive, so starting breakfast with sweets can make you crave snacking all day.
Dishes that are too salty, with a lot of spices... are also not good for health, especially for the kidneys.

Some notes about breakfast when reducing belly fat
To build an effective breakfast menu to reduce belly fat, you need to pay attention to the following:
1. Adjust your diet accordingly
Each person has different calorie needs, depending on age, gender, activity needs, health status... Therefore, when designing a belly fat-reducing breakfast, it is necessary to calculate and adjust the calorie level most suitable for yourself but still ensure a belly fat-reducing diet.
For example: people with a high need to be active, regularly playing sports... should supplement a lot of protein and healthy fats to meet their energy needs. Elderly people should limit foods high in fat, salt and sugar...
2. Don't miss breakfast
Many people believe that skipping breakfast will help them lose weight faster by cutting down on calorie intake.
However, that is still unclear. When you skip breakfast, your body is at risk of lack of energy, leading to reduced work performance, lack of concentration, fatigue and even more cravings for snacks.
Therefore, you should maintain the habit of eating breakfast with healthy, nutritious foods, scientific portions.
